A leading international real estate investment manager is seeking an Analyst/Senior Analyst to join its Asset Management team.

This is a highly analytical and commercial role focused on the active management and value creation of a significant portfolio of real estate assets. The successful candidate will work across financial modelling, business planning, capital expenditure analysis and asset-level strategy, supporting senior members of the team in identifying and executing initiatives to improve investment performance.

The role offers significant exposure to operational real estate, and candidates with experience across sectors such as hotels, student accommodation, multifamily/BTR, healthcare or senior living are particularly encouraged. However, broader real estate backgrounds will also be considered where candidates can demonstrate strong technical and asset management capabilities.

Responsibilities

  • Build and maintain detailed asset-level financial models from scratch, including cash flows, valuations and returns analysis.
  • Undertake scenario and sensitivity analysis to assess different asset management strategies and investment outcomes.
  • Model and evaluate capital expenditure initiatives, including ROI, yield-on-cost and impact on asset value and returns.
  • Support the preparation and execution of asset-level business plans, budgets and forecasts.
  • Analyse financial and operational performance, identifying trends, risks and opportunities for value creation.
  • Monitor performance against underwriting and business plans and investigate key variances.
  • Support strategic asset management initiatives including capex programmes, operational improvements, refinancings and other value-add projects.
  • Work closely with operating partners and internal Investments, Finance, Operations and Capital Projects teams.
  • Prepare investment analysis, recommendations and materials for senior management.
  • Visit assets to develop a detailed understanding of their operational and financial performance.

What we’re looking for

Candidates should have a strong grounding in real estate financial analysis and asset management, with particular emphasis on technical capability.

Successful candidates are likely to demonstrate:

  • Strong financial modelling skills with the ability to build real estate models from scratch.
  • Experience modelling cash flows, valuations, investment returns and business plans.
  • Strong understanding of capex modelling, scenario analysis, sensitivities, ROI and yield-on-cost.
  • Experience analysing asset performance and understanding the drivers of revenue, costs, NOI and investment returns.
  • Exposure to asset management activities such as budgeting, forecasting, business planning, capex, valuations, leasing, refinancing or hold/sell analysis.
  • Strong analytical ability and commercial judgement, with the ability to translate detailed financial analysis into clear recommendations.
  • An interest in operational real estate and understanding how operational performance ultimately drives asset-level returns.
  • Experience within hotels, PBSA/student accommodation, multifamily/BTR, healthcare, senior living or other operational real estate sectors would be advantageous but is not essential.

Requirements

  • Experience within real estate asset management, investment management, acquisitions, real estate private equity, lending, investment banking or a comparable analytical environment.
  • Advanced Excel and financial modelling capability.
  • Strong numerical and analytical skills.
  • Ability to manage detailed workstreams with a high degree of accuracy and ownership.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Commercial curiosity and a genuine interest in understanding both the financial and operational drivers of real estate performance.
